Introduction to Climate Disaster Insurance Swaps

Climate disaster insurance swaps are a type of financial instrument that enables individuals, businesses, and governments to manage and transfer the risk of climate-related disasters, such as hurricanes, wildfires, and floods. This concept has been gaining traction, especially with the increasing frequency and severity of climate disasters worldwide. How Climate Disaster Insurance Swaps Work

Climate disaster insurance swaps involve a contractual agreement between two parties, where one party agrees to pay a premium to the other in exchange for a payout in the event of a climate-related disaster. This arrangement allows individuals and businesses to hedge against potential losses and provides a financial safety net in the face of uncertainty. Challenges and Limitations of Climate Disaster Insurance Swaps

Despite the potential benefits of climate disaster insurance swaps, there are several challenges and limitations that need to be addressed. These include the complexity of climate-related risks, the lack of standardization in climate disaster insurance swaps, and the need for regulatory frameworks to govern the market.

Additionally, climate disaster insurance swaps may not be accessible to all individuals and businesses, particularly those in developing countries or with limited financial resources.
